Exploring copyright Features: A In-depth Analysis
The Android package file, or copyright, holds a treasure trove of information beyond just the app’s visible interface. Investigating these internal features is crucial for creators, safety researchers, and even curious users. Beyond the basic deployment process, an copyright can display a wealth of data, including permitted permissions – allowing you to see what capabilities the app requests, such as location access or camera application. Moreover, analyzing the copyright’s manifest file offers insight into compatible device features, screen dimensions, and required Android versions. Reverse engineering, while potentially difficult, can unveil a underlying code, although this often raises ethical and legal questions. Ultimately, a thorough copyright assessment allows for a much greater appreciation of the app’s design and potential restrictions.
Comprehending Android Packages
So, you've curious about application packages? These small files are the core of the Android environment, acting as executable packages holding everything needed to run an application on your device. Essentially, an copyright is like a compressed archive – a combination of code, resources (like images and layouts), and manifest files that describe the app's features and permissions. Understanding how they work might provide a deeper understanding into the Android universe and potentially allow some advanced personalization. Don't fear; it's never as difficult as it looks!

APKs & Applications Installation, Management, and Troubleshooting
Dealing with installable files on your Android device can be straightforward, but sometimes issues arise. Installation an copyright directly, bypassing the Google Play Store, is a common practice, often for modifications, requiring you to enable "Unknown Sources" or similar permissions in your apk que es device's security menu. Once set up, managing these apps – especially those not from official stores – can involve using alternative launchers, file explorers, or even specialized app tools to keep them organized and under control. Common troubleshooting scenarios include issues installing – often resolved by clearing cache, verifying the copyright's integrity, or ensuring sufficient storage room. Incompatibilities with other applications, unexpected crashes, or slow speed can sometimes be addressed by resetting the app, checking for updates, or examining permissions granted to it. A clean cache is often a easy first step to resolving many problems.
